Abstract
The utility model provides a tower cross arm with pedals, comprising two cross arm webs, a cross arm upper wing plate, a cross arm lower wing plate, a cross arm support plate, a cross arm line hanging plate, an installation handrail and a plurality of pedals, wherein the two cross arm weds are parallel to each other and is vertical to the ground; the cross arm upper wing plate and the cross arm lower wing plate are respectively and fixedly connected with the top and the bottom of the cross arm web, the directions of the wing plates are vertical to the cross arm web; the cross arm support plate is arranged on the end of the cross arm web, near a tower, and is fixed between the two cross arm webs, and the direction of the cross arm support plate is parallel to the ground; the cross arm line hanging plate is fixed on the end part of the cross arm web, far way from the tower, and the direction of the cross arm line hanging plate is vertical to the ground; the installation handrail is fixedly connected with the web upper wing plate; and the plurality of pedals are welded on the cross arm lower wing plate and are long circle frames formed by bending circular tubes and welded on the lower plane of the cross arm lower wing plate along the length direction of the cross arm of the tower. The tower cross arm with the pedals has the advantages of being capable of reducing the potential safety hazards of line hanging and enhancing the efficiency of line hanging.

Background technology
Article one, power transmission sequence is to be begun by a transformer station, finishes to another transformer station.Village, farmland, forest and high mountain will be passed through in the centre, cross over river, highway, railway, power circuit and communication line etc.; Run into major facility and impassable obstacle need avoid detouring, walking dog leg path.Cross-arm is an ingredient important in the shaft tower, and its effect is to be used for installing insulator and gold utensil, with support conductors, lightning conducter, and makes it the safe distance that keeps certain in accordance with regulations.It is the member of forming by welding, is connected to the shaft tower pipe shaft with bolt then and brings into play its hanging wire function.
When carrying out work high above the ground when hanging wire and maintenance, the people often needs to climb and carries out the hanging wire operation to shaft tower cross-arm end.Existing shaft tower cross-arm is simple in order to process, and saves material, and most of cross-arms all do not have the aid and the measure of hanging wire, thereby has brought very big inconvenience to installer's construction.
